What are some real-world examples of First-Come, First-Served (FCFS) systems?
FCFS is commonly used in various scenarios. For instance, in operating systems, processes are scheduled in the order they arrive.
Can you give me more examples?
Sure! In customer service, FCFS is used in queues at banks or restaurants. Also, in print spooling, documents are printed in the order they are received.
Are there any disadvantages to using FCFS?
Yes, one major disadvantage is the potential for the 'convoy effect,' where shorter tasks wait for longer ones, leading to inefficiency.
How does FCFS compare to other scheduling algorithms?
FCFS is simple and easy to implement, but it can be less efficient than algorithms like Shortest Job First (SJF) or Round Robin, especially in time-sharing systems.
